An immigrant covers his life in the Philippines, immigration to Hawaii, field work in Koloa and Kekaha, mill work and truck driving, and plantation housing. He also describes chicken fights and taxi dances where he played bass in a band.
sugar plantation laborer, sugar plantation mill worker, truck driver; Filipino; male
Interview conducted in English.
